Property Description for 50 East 89th Street, 23-FG

Incredible views and endless possibilities meet you at this approximately 2000 square foot home high atop Carnegie Hill. This 2 bedroom (convertible 3), 2.5 bath apartment with home office is in a most desirable location. Light pours in from Southern and Western directions and each primary room has a Central Park Reservoir or City view. The master and second bedrooms have direct reservoir views and the master is ensuite with a large walk-in closet. Also benefiting from a reservoir view, the windowed kitchen has an eat-in area and ample storage and counter space . And of course, the added bonus is the home office or playroom. Step on to the generous-sized balcony and take in the panoramic City view. Pull right up to the front door of The Park Regis through the PORTE COCHERE over the private driveway, unload your car and park in the GARAGE, which is discounted for tenants! This coveted address is accessible to the best schools in NYC (including P.S. 6), Museum Mile, Madison Avenue shopping, restaurants and transportation. Additional top-notch services include, 24-hour doorman, concierge, resident property manager, fitness center, bicycle storage and landscaped garden. PET FRIENDLY! NO FLIP TAX!

Carnegie Hill | Manhattan

Quick Profile

Carnegie Hill is a small neighborhood at the northern tip of the Upper East Side that borders Central Park. It is steeped in history, great wealth, architecture and culture. It is known for its world-class museums and its rows of historic mansions. Nothing much changes here as the entire area is landmarked, preventing the proliferation of high-rise developments. Thus the buildings stay a human scale, the sky is aplenty and the neighborhood kind of feels like a small town to its long time residents.

The name Carnegie Hill is derived from the industrial magnate Andrew Carnegie, when Carnegie decided to build himself a mansion at 91st Street and Fifth Avenue….

Carnegie Hill is a family neighborhood with old fashioned upper crust money. The mid-rise co-ops that line the avenues are among the most prestigious addresses in the city. The avenues are lined with small restaurants, boutique shops

The residential towers that have proliferated on the eastside of Third Avenue in the East 90s simply do not exist between Lexington and Fifth.
